1 Introduction With Connection Suite 2.10 Dualog AS introduce numerous new features and improvements from previous version. This document describes important issues to take into consideration when upgrading and configuring, where to find new features and changes to previous functionality. A short description of what is new and how to use new features is also included. Also the shore side of Connection Suite, https://dualog.net is upgraded accordingly. This document does not describe the new features available on https://dualog.net. 2 Upgrading to Connection Suite 2.10 When installing on Windows 7 and server versions of Windows, it important that the installation is run when logged in as local admin. Please note that from 2.10 a new installation tool is now in use for installation of Connection Suite Standard and DuaCore Pro. This does not influence the users experience. PortMapper and DHCP server is already using the new installation tool. 2.1 Upgrading Connection Suite Standard When upgrading to Connection Suite Standard to version 2.10, no special action is required during upgrade. The installation program will shut down all services, upgrade databases and other sources, and start the new services after upgrade. All new configuration options will be downloaded on the first connects, so it is important to do several manual connects after the installation is completed. 2.2 Upgrading DuaCore Pro In version 2.10 there are new low-level drivers for DuaCore Pro. To avoid any problems, a uninstall of DuaCore Pro is required before installing DuaCore Pro 2.10 Also, it is important that Connection Suite Standard 2.10 is installed BEFORE installing DuaCore Pro 2.10: 1. Upgrade to Connection Suite 2.10 Standard 2. Uninstall DuaCore Pro. 3. Reboot computer 4. Install DuaCore Pro 2.3 Upgrading PortMapper and DHCP server No major changes are made to PortMapper and DHCP server in version 2.10. Upgrade is straight-forward, so no special action is required. 2.4 Services running after the upgrade The following services related to Connection Suite should be running after the upgrade. Please note that Services installed for extensions is not in this list.: Name Decsription Function Dualog Service Manager Dualog service that controls email traffic Main service, controlling communication, Least Cost Routing, mailserver and other services DualogConfigBeacon Dualog service providing config information to remote components. Only in use when running Connection Suite Services on remote computers. Delivers configuration settings from the Oracle Database DualogConnectionSuiteWebServer Serving the Dualog connection suite clients WebServer handling Connection Suite Flash GUI Dualog Apache Server Apache/2.2.14 (Win32) PHP/5.3.1 WebServer handling WebMail Dualog Connection Suite LDAP Server Dualog Connection Suite LDAP Service Address book server Dualog PortMapper Service Dualog service controlling low level communication Optional. 3 New features in Connection Suite 2.10 Several new functions and Extensions have been added to Connection Suite 2.10. Some of which will be automatically available in our standard package, others as Connection Suite Extensions. 3.1 New basic Functionality - overview 3.1.1 New WebMail WebMail is now available from My page: Click on the WebMail menu item to access WebMail. The new WebMail contain several new features, in addition to improvements from the old WebMail: Create your own folders, with subfolders Save messages as drafts Utilizes the new IMAP Server included in Connection Suite Utilizes the new LDAP server included in Connection Suite Improvements in handling/controlling messages in inbox HTML or plain text editor Drag-and-drop messages between folders User interface resizable 3.1.2 LDAP Server The LDAP (Lightweight Directory Access Protocol) server makes the Connection Suite Address Book and list of users available for external e-mail clients, as well as the new WebMail application in Connection Suite. For 2.10, only read is implemented, so it is not possible to edit or add entries to the database. This will be available in a later version of Connection Suite. 3.2 New and improved Extensions Extensions are additional services to be added to the Connection Suite installation. Most Extensions are supplied as separate installation programs. The following new extensions are available in Connection Suite 2.10 3.2.1 Web4Sea Dualog Web4Sea is a new service developed to control and optimize web activities. It is recommended to run Web4Sea together with DuaCore pro, to get an optimal setup for controlling IP traffic. Web4Sea is a maritime Web proxy with additional features to control each user s access to internet: Access rights per communication system Cache only access Content filtering Traffic shaping 3.2.2 AntiVirus Dualog has not invented its own Antivirus system. Dualog Antivirus is using the ESET NOD32 antivirus client, by integrating it into Connection Suite in terms of pattern distribution, installation and control of versions onboard ships. Installation of onboard software is described in separate documents. Please note that there is a separate installation for server (where the Connection Suite installation resides) and client computers onboard the ship. Pattern distribution is optimized to reduce cost, as files distributed are reduced to a minimum. No IP connection is required to distribute patterns to ships, and can therefore be sent on any communication system. Page 6 of 11

When new updates are received onboard ships, an acknowledgement is returned to shore, giving administrators the opportunity to monitor each ship installation on dualog.net. Distribution of patterns and acknowledgements are displayed in the figure below: 3.2.3 DuaCore Pro Based on feedback from our customers, several improvements are now available in DuaCore Pro. Also, several critical bugs are now fixed. We urge every customer to upgrade to DuaCore Pro version 2.10 as soon as possible. Main new features: Compatible with Windows 7, Windows 2003 Server, Windows 2008 Server Possible to set several destination addresses (IP addresses) per rule Possible to add several IP ports per service Bug fixes in handling of Least Cost Routing and communication failover. 3.3 Configuring new features Some of the improvements made from previous versions require configuration changes before they are available for users. It is important to note that these changes can be made on shore, and will be replicated to ships when an upgrade is finalized. Please be aware that several connections are required before configuration is synchronized and all updates are available on the ship. When all updates are available, please do a logout-login in the Connection Suite user interface. Page 7 of 11

3.3.1 User group configuration As new functions are available, User Group Function Access must be modified according to company policy. It is important to notice that these settings must be changed on shore (dualog.net). The following new functions are available: Antivirus Ship overview (dualog.net only) Web4Sea Web4Sea Company Web4Sea Traffic WebMail various duplicates will appear in the list Default configuration when new features are introduced is No access. For each user group, please make sure that new features are made available for those user groups intended to see the new features. 3.3.2 Antivirus All Antivirus configurations have to be done by Dualog AS. 3.3.3 WebMail and e-mail configuration With the introduction of new WebMail and IMAP Server, configuration of e-mail has changed radically from previous versions. New options are available, but most importantly, more configuration options must be set per user group. The net result is that user group access together with ships configuration sets what e-mail system a user have access to. When upgrading, most re-configuring for the new platform is automatically performed by the installation program. However it is advised to check that all configurations are according to requirements: 3.3.3.1 User group access In 2.10 there are three different ways of handling received e-mail: POP3 For use with external standalone e-mail clients SMTP Relay Relaying to 3 rd party mail servers like Microsoft Exchange or Lotus Domino Server onboard the ships IMAP4 Currently only available for WebMail. Must be ticked for all Webmail users (groups) The most common configuration is shown in the screen below. Page 9 of 11

3.3.3.2 E-mail configuration For each ship, available e-mail systems must be set. The available options are equal to those set per User Group (section 3.3.3.1). In the list each User Group s access to e-mail services can then be configured. Available options will be set depending on ships availability and User Group access. In a normal situation no configuration is required as available options will be enabled. The following configuration must be set, depending on E-mail systems selected: POP3: When using external e-mail clients like Outlook, Outlook Express, Windows Mail or Thunderbird Hostname (IP address of computer running Connection Suite) SMTP port, normally 25 POP3 port, normally 110 IMAP4: Optional: LDAP port, only if Connection Suite Address Book & User list should be available from e-mail client Currently this option is only available when using the Connection Suite WebMail client.
